Cedar roof replacement services involve removing an existing cedar shingle or shake roof and installing a new one to restore the roof’s integrity and appearance. The process typically includes inspecting the existing roof structure, removing the old cedar materials, and preparing the surface for the new installation. Professionals may also address underlying issues such as rotting wood or damaged decking to ensure the new roof provides long-lasting protection. This service is essential for maintaining the durability and aesthetic appeal of properties that feature cedar roofing materials.
One primary benefit of cedar roof replacement is resolving issues caused by aging or weather-related damage. Over time, cedar shingles or shakes can develop cracks, rot, or warping, which may lead to leaks, water damage, or structural deterioration. Replacing the roof helps prevent further problems by ensuring the roofing system remains secure and weather-resistant. Cost Range - Cedar roof replacement costs typically range from $7,000 to $15,000 for an average-sized home. Larger or more complex projects can exceed $20,000, depending on the roof size and condition.
Material Costs - The price of cedar shingles or shakes usually accounts for about 50% of the total project cost. Premium grades or thicker materials tend to increase the overall expense.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for cedar roof replacement can vary between $3,000 and $8,000. Factors influencing this include roof complexity, height, and local labor rates.
Additional Fees - Extra costs may include roof removal, disposal, and repairs, which can add several thousand dollars to the total. These expenses depend on the existing roof's condition and removal difficulty.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should cedar roofs be replaced? The lifespan of a cedar roof typically ranges from 20 to 30 years, but replacement may be necessary sooner if there are extensive damages or deterioration. Consulting local contractors can help determine the appropriate timing for replacement based on the roof's condition.
What are signs that indicate a cedar roof needs replacement? Indicators include widespread rot, significant moss or mold growth, extensive cracked or missing shingles, and persistent leaks. A professional inspection can identify if replacement is the best option.
Are cedar roof replacements more expensive than other roofing options? Cedar roof replacements tend to have higher upfront costs compared to asphalt shingles, but their durability and aesthetic appeal may offer long-term value. Local service providers can provide estimates based on specific needs.
Can a cedar roof be repaired instead of replaced? Minor damages or localized rot can often be repaired, but extensive deterioration usually requires full replacement. A local contractor can assess whether repairs are sufficient or if replacement is recommended.
